Buying Guide: Key Considerations For UV Lights In Hot Tubs

Efficiency and compatibility are the core factors when choosing a UV light for a hot tub. Assess the system capacity (gallons) and ensure the UV-C unit is rated for that range. Look for dual-tube designs, which typically provide more stable performance and longer life. Consider whether the unit is designed for submersion and how it handles safety seals and waterproofing. A gravity block simplifies placement and keeps the lamp upright to maximize exposure. Do not expose fish directly to UV-C light; position lamps behind filters or in water flow zones where water is moving.

Durability and installation also matter. Upgraded packaging reduces the chance of tube damage during shipping and handling. A long power cord (17 feet is common) improves installation flexibility, allowing distant mounting from outlets. Quartz glass clarity affects UV transmission; higher-quality quartz helps maintain peak disinfection. If you maintain multiple water features, choose a unit with a robust sealing mechanism and a design that resists leakage over time.

Safety and maintenance are essential. UV-C disinfection does not remove physical debris; it targets microorganisms and odors at the DNA level. Combine UV treatment with filtration and regular cleaning to maintain water clarity. For aquariums, place the lamp behind the filter where water flows to avoid direct exposure to fish. Regularly inspect seals, test water quality, and replace UV lamps per manufacturer guidelines to sustain effectiveness.

Bottom line: For hot tubs and related water features, selecting a UV light with dual-tube UV-C, reliable waterproofing, and a gravity-oriented design yields consistent performance. Consider your tub size, installation space, and whether you need a 20W, 32W, or higher-wattage model to maintain optimal water clarity and odor control.
